Fyodor Dostoyevsky
, a Russian novelist and short-story writer whose psychological penetration into the darkest recesses of the human heart, together with his unsurpassed moments of illumination, had an immense influence on 20th-century fiction. He is commonly regarded as one of the finest novelists who ever lived, penning works including four long Crime and Punishment, The Idiot, Demons, and The Brothers Karamazov.

Leo Tolstoy (1828-1910) was a Russian author, a master of realistic fiction, and one of the world’s greatest novelists. He is best known for his two longest works, War and Peace and Anna Karenina, which are commonly regarded as among the finest novels ever written.
